Good Evening,
I deployed the bitnami azure instance of sutieCRM 8.3, and while most things appear to be working, the jobs never actually execute. I have followed the ultimate schedulers guide and everything - fixed my crontab - and the system log even says it is running! Can someone please help me get my scheduler working?
Image used: SuiteCRM Cloud Hosting on Azure
The only way I can get jobs to appear on the schedular as having ran, is by running the cron.php file manually in CLI, as bitnami user:
cd /bitnami/suitecrm/public/legacy; php -f cron.php > /dev/null 2>&1
Somehow when I run that manually, my scheduled jobs run once in suiteCRM.
Here is the tail of my logs (You can see I threw the kitchen sink at this, and have root, daemon, and bitnami running):
Aug 7 02:33:12 HCFCRM dhclient[522]: XMT: Solicit on eth0, interval 113740ms.
Aug 7 02:34:01 HCFCRM CRON[41657]: (daemon) CMD (nohup php -f /bitnami/suitecrm/public/legacy/cron.php > /dev/null 2>&1 &)
Aug 7 02:34:01 HCFCRM CRON[41658]: (bitnami) CMD (cd /bitnami/suitecrm/public/legacy; php -f cron.php > /dev/null 2>&1)
Aug 7 02:34:01 HCFCRM CRON[41656]: (root) CMD (cd /bitnami/suitecrm/public/legacy; php -f cron.php > /dev/null 2>&1)
Aug 7 02:34:01 HCFCRM CRON[41659]: (daemon) CMD (cd /opt/bitnami/suitecrm; /opt/bitnami/php/bin/php -f cron.php > /dev/null 2>&1)
Aug 7 02:35:01 HCFCRM CRON[41668]: (bitnami) CMD (cd /bitnami/suitecrm/public/legacy; php -f cron.php > /dev/null 2>&1)
Aug 7 02:35:01 HCFCRM CRON[41667]: (daemon) CMD (cd /opt/bitnami/suitecrm; /opt/bitnami/php/bin/php -f cron.php > /dev/null 2>&1)
Aug 7 02:35:01 HCFCRM CRON[41669]: (daemon) CMD (nohup php -f /bitnami/suitecrm/public/legacy/cron.php > /dev/null 2>&1 &)
Aug 7 02:35:01 HCFCRM CRON[41670]: (root) CMD (cd /bitnami/suitecrm/public/legacy; php -f cron.php > /dev/null 2>&1)
Cron Service Status response:
● cron.service - Regular background program processing daemon
Loaded: loaded (/lib/systemd/system/cron.service; enabled; vendor preset: enabled)
Active: active (running) since Mon 2023-08-07 01:33:11 UTC; 12min ago
Docs: man:cron(8)
Main PID: 40642 (cron)
Tasks: 1 (limit: 19188)
Memory: 360.0K
CPU: 684ms
CGroup: /system.slice/cron.service
└─40642 /usr/sbin/cron -f
Aug 07 01:45:01 HCFCRM CRON[40854]: pam_unix(cron:session): session opened for user bitnami(uid=1000) by (uid=0)
Aug 07 01:45:01 HCFCRM CRON[40856]: (daemon) CMD (cd /opt/bitnami/suitecrm; /opt/bitnami/php/bin/php -f cron.php > /dev/null 2>&1)
Aug 07 01:45:01 HCFCRM CRON[40857]: (bitnami) CMD (su -c “cd /bitnami/suitecrm/public/legacy; php -f cron.php > /dev/null 2>&1” bitnami)
Aug 07 01:45:01 HCFCRM CRON[40855]: pam_unix(cron:session): session closed for user daemon
Aug 07 01:45:01 HCFCRM CRON[40853]: pam_unix(cron:session): session closed for user root
Aug 07 01:45:01 HCFCRM su[40860]: pam_unix(su:auth): auth could not identify password for [bitnami]
Aug 07 01:45:01 HCFCRM su[40860]: FAILED SU (to bitnami) bitnami on none
Aug 07 01:45:01 HCFCRM CRON[40852]: pam_unix(cron:session): session closed for user daemon
Aug 07 01:45:02 HCFCRM CRON[40854]: (CRON) info (No MTA installed, discarding output)
Aug 07 01:45:02 HCFCRM CRON[40854]: pam_unix(cron:session): session closed for user bitnami